Meteorological agencies across Japan are monitoring a significant shift in atmospheric patterns as the rainy season, known as tsuyu, intensifies across the country. While the northern and eastern regions prepare for increased precipitation and heightened humidity, the Okinawa region is approaching the typical end of its monsoon period, according to data provided by the Japan Meteorological Agency (JMA).
The weather outlook for the coming week indicates that the seasonal rain front will become more active, particularly from the latter half of the week. This shift is expected to bring widespread rainfall to eastern and western Japan, marking a transition into a more persistent, humid rainy-season climate. Shifting Weather Patterns and Regional Impacts
The transition into the latter half of June is characterized by the northward movement of the Pacific high-pressure system, which influences the positioning of the stationary rain front. In northern and eastern Japan, this will manifest as increased cloud cover and frequent showers. Meteorologists emphasize that the combination of high humidity and rising temperatures creates conditions conducive to heatstroke, even on days where rain is not constant.

The Japan Meteorological Agency maintains that the rainy season typically involves a series of active fronts that move across the archipelago. Okinawa and the Impending End of the Rainy Season
In contrast to the mainland, the Okinawa region is nearing the conclusion of its rainy season. Historically, the end of the rainy season in Okinawa occurs around late June. While weather patterns can fluctuate annually, current observations suggest that the subtropical high is strengthening, which typically pushes the rain front further north, effectively ending the monsoon for the islands.

However, the transition period in Okinawa often brings intense, short-duration downpours before the final onset of stable summer heat.
